Position Summary:

The Stravitz‐Sanyal Institute for Liver Disease and Metabolic Health (SSLI) is searching for an experienced finance professional for the position of Senior Financial Specialist. The position will provide fiscal and budgetary support and perform fiscal duties including procurement, financial management and analysis, purchase card and petty cash management, fixed asset custodian, reconciliations and reporting.

Core Responsibilities:

Financial Management & Budget Development (30%)

-Conduct financial analyses and assessments to support decision-making regarding resource allocation
-Participate in the annual budget development process and make recommendations for upcoming budget cycle
-Work with COO to realign budgets, assist research administration team with monitoring research accounts
-Provide guidance and training to researchers/staff and project staff on RealSource and RealTime policies, procedures, and systems, promoting financial literacy and responsible stewardship of funds

Accounting & Fiscal Functions (35%):

-Promptly and accurately process all financial transactions. Monitor appropriate spending of Institute funds, maintain awareness of programmatic issues and escalate any potential problem areas
-Reconcile assigned indexes on a monthly basis using reports from VCU and MCV Foundation. Practices routine verification of the accuracy of data per university policy. Verify all indexes and account codes are accurate and complete journal vouchers as needed.
-Track spending on research awards/pilot funds.
-Maintains current knowledge of state, University and School policies, and applies these policies accurately to all fiscal transactions, maintaining proper documentation for audit trail
-Work with COO and SOM to accurately process journal vouchers and budget entries
-Produce accurate and timely reports for leadership
Serve as the fixed asset custodian and maintain records for Department.

Procurement Services (30%):

-Processes purchase requests adhering to University Procurement Services' policies and procedures
-Support complex procurement and contract processing
-Follow up as needed to ensure timely requisition receiving and payment of all university invoices according to established policies and procedures
-Responsible for timely review and approval of PCard reports/transactions for cardholders using the Bank of America Works website
-Responsible for timely sign-off of transactions and submission of Pcard reports to supervisor, as a card holder in the Department
-Provide oversight on research study patient payments
-Create travel and personal reimbursement requests in Chrome River within established state, university and institute travel policies and procedures from pre-authorizations to reimbursements
-Provide training to faculty and staff with travel guidelines and funding for travel
-Maintain current knowledge of state, University and Department policies and procedures and apply these accurately to all transactions
-Train department personnel, travelers and timekeepers in VCU financial systems
-Support purchasing or timekeeping duties during other staff members' extended leaves of absence or vacancy

Other duties as assigned (5%)

Assist with or manage special projects at the direction of Institute leadership.
